WebYes, a sprig of thyme is one branch with multiple leaves. It is typically a small branch that measures about 3-4 inches in length. A sprig of thyme refers to the leaves and stem of the herb that are picked from the stem and used to flavor dishes. Sprigs of thyme are most commonly used in soups, sauces, and casseroles, as well as to garnish salads.
